Abstract

A specific method is provided of improving immunomodulatory properties of Lactobacillus strains using growth media with a specific primary carbon source, including a method of increasing the anti-inflammatory effect of non-pathogenic anti-inflammatory bacterial strains, by the use of specific growth conditions.

A method for enhancing the anti-inflammatory effects of anti-inflammatory lactic acid bacteria by growing the lactic acid bacteria on a specific carbon source selected from the group consisting of glucose, lactose, fructose, starch and 1,2-propanediol and administering the lactic acid bacteria to a mammal. 
     
     
         3 . A method of enhancing anti-inflammatory effects of an anti-inflammatory strain of  Lactobacillus reuteri  comprising growing the strain of Lactobacillus reuteri in a medium comprising a carbon source selected from a group consisting of glucose, lactose, fructose, starch and 1,2-propanediol and administering the strain of  Lactobacillus reuteri  to a mammal. 
     
     
         4 . The method of  claim 3 , where the  Lactobacillus reuteri  strain is ATCC PTA 6475. 
     
     
         5 . The method of  claim 3 , where the  Lactobacillus reuteri  strain is ATCC PTA 5289.
